We are currently seeking a Water Resources Engineer with at least 8 years of experience to join our family of engineers and scientists to support municipal, state, federal, and private projects in the southeast and throughout the nation. This is an engaging and high impact position in which you will work closely with national industry leaders to support clients with stormwater management and design, dam assessments and rehabilitation, green infrastructure (GI), low impact development (LID), hydrologic and hydraulic (H&H) analysis, water quantity and water quality analysis, resiliency solutions, and watershed and coastal management projects. In this position you will work as a team member to support routine and non-routine assignments related to environmental projects of substantial variety and complexity.

Your Roleand Responsibilities:

  • Support and/or lead stormwater management projects focused on green infrastructure and low impact development
  • Support and/or lead in design analysis through application of quantitative and qualitative evaluation techniques
  • Support in the preparation of construction documents (plans and specifications)
  • Support and/or lead cost-benefit analysis
  • Conduct hydrologic and hydraulic analyses
  • Analyze watershed and water quality data using GIS and statistical techniques
  • Develop or prepare descriptive charts, figures/maps, and tables/matrices
  • Perform writing assignments to contribute to project documentation and deliverables such as memos and reports
  • Provide design criteria and permitting support for stormwater, watershed management, and other watershed projects
  • Assist with quality control and assurance
  • Provide technical training to junior staff on above projects 

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ree (Master's preferred) in environmental/civil engineering (or a related field) 
  • Active Professional Engineer (PE) certification in the State of Georgia, North Carolina, and/or Florida with 8 or more years of relevant engineering experience
  • Demonstrated educational and relevant work experience showing strong analytical, written, and verbal communication skills
  • Strong background in stormwater design and/or watershed management
  • Proficiency in AutoCAD Civil 3D and ArcGIS preferred
  • Experience with HEC-RAS, SWMM, and/or ICPR
  • Desire to learn other design software programs
  • Computer literate; knowledge of MS Word and Excel
  • Ability to provide technical support for business development and be mentored for future business development initiatives.
